Rugby Station - LMS Period Locomotives: lnwrrm998
Ex-LNWR 4-4-0 3P Precursor class No 5300 'Hydra' stands at
the head of a down local passenger train. These locomotives were once the
premier express design on the LNWR but by the late twenties had been relegated
to lowly local passenger duties. In this 1929 view of 'Hydra' she still bore
the running number 5300 which would shortly be used as part of the Stanier
Black 5 allocated numbers. 'Hydra' would be renumbered in the 20000 series, the
so called duplicate list, giving her the number 25300. Built at Crewe works as
LNWR No 4491 in August 1905 No 5300 was scrapped in July 1940.
